Starbolts #438: True Love or Fantasy



Hail!

There is a lot to unpack this week. Sam and I were initially going to try to write Tanis as sympathetic and jealous this week. That has proven to be a very hard task to pull off. I don't think he's sympathetic at all to be honest. He's jealous of Marcus and always has been and now he wants to try and save Damselfly the same way Marcus saved Crystal and Firaxil saved Dennis. However, there's a bit of a problem with that.

When Firaxil saved Sara, it took some time for her to open up to him. Crystal also had an emotional wall around her too. Just a different type. So it stands to reason that Damselfly and the other members of this "Sinister Six" team I have here are going to be messed up should they decide to defect from Terra Nova. We will see what happened then.

For now it looks like Sara has been put right back to work the second she got home from vacation. They are supposed to be celebrating the engagement! Don't worry. Celebrations will be had. Count on it!

Starbolts #437: Sinister Temptation



Hail!

Tanis, what are the Starbolts going to do with you? I want it understood that Tanis knew what he was doing when he went after Damselfly. That dust wasn't hypnotic or anything. As I'll explain in the next comic it's more like an aphrodisiac. The female of the species produces dust from her wings to attract a mate. And....that's what she did. Sufficed it to say that the Starbolts are going to be angry at Tanis over this for a very long time.

In any event, the Starbolts lost the first round with the so-called Sinister Six. I know that name's taken. I just thought I'd call 'em that. They'll have to regroup and recover while four members of the team will be out of commission for a while. Don't worry. Firaxil and Sara will be back next comic. Crystal is probably going to ask her a few questions. Namely....why did Mr. Mental call her Whisper? Hmmm....So many questions.

Enjoy the comic! Man, I wouldn't want to be in Tanis's shoes right now.

Starbolts #435: Ridiculously Over-the-Top Supervillains





Hail!

Why settle for one ridiculously over-the-top supervillain when you can have seven? New Terra Nova recruits are just aching to challenge the Starbolts and that's just what they'll do very, very soon. They come from all over Earth and at least one of them came from Demonsk. Demonsk, by the way, is the home realm of Starbolts baddie Demonstorm. It's also where Tanis of the Starbolts is from.

I introduced these characters a while back as a symbol of things to come. Looks like they'll be having an impact soon. The trick to creating these characters is to counter the abilities of each Starbolt. It doesn't look it. But, Damselfly does have retractable bug-like wings like Tanis does. We'll be seeing them soon.

We also have a bit of a mystery. Who is Doctor Adams talking to? Whoever it is has a rather intimate knowledge of the Starbolts. The person called Sara Project Sola. It doesn't take much to figure out who Project Whisper is supposed to be. (Yes, it's Crystal.)

The Starbolts are definitely gonna have their hands full with "Project Redemption". Terra Nova isn't as gone as we thought it was!

Starbolts #433: Moving Forward



Hail!

Looks like things are moving forward for our heroines, Crystal and Sara. Though, the She-Ra thing is more than likely going to be a one-off thing. I talked to Sam about it and we both agreed that Crystal on her own is pretty formidable. She has razor sharp claws, invisibility and cat-like reflexes. She doesn't need a She-Ra style armor. If anything, that get-up would impede her movements. Still, it might be good for a costume party or something. Right now she's as good as is and that's how Sam and I like her. Will she achieve her true potential? Time will tell. The only reason Marcus didn't transform is because he already achieved his full heroic potential. Crystal will get there some day. If anything, the sword is telling her that she has much more to do.

Sara on the other hand? Well, we have plans for her. I'm not at liberty to say what they are. But, I have a feeling it might be obvious. You don't just take a woman away with you to a romantic spot on a far away planet for kicks. Firaxil is up to something. Next week we'll find out what that something is.
